Much of the root problem is economics, not necessarily a blanket statement but so often in poor areas we see home sites terribly littered.  Homes run down, cars on blocks or rusting out somewhere on the property, trash and garbage not tended to correctly, a simple disrespect for their own environment.  This attitude transcends into our public roads, lands and water ways.  It is not isolated to any one ethnic group or area of the country, it's everywhere.  

I've been to some really beautiful countries, the littering was terrible and often times adjacent to 5 star resorts.  Some 40 years ago I took several trips into the wilderness of northern Canada, as pristine as it was a trail of beer cans was always evident.  I may add there was heavy industrial machinery just rusting out, again it's economics but not from the poor.  It's more cost saving to take the depreciation of the equipment than to physical move it.

I participated in a river clean up on a river that ran through an affluent community. One of the most common pieces of garbage I picked up from the river was plastic bags filled with dog waste. People pick up after their dogs where people can see them, then when they get out of site, they throw the bags in the river. This is done by some of the wealthiest residents in the area.
